Preparing the Ideal Foundation for Your Concrete Patio in Salt Lake City
A solid foundation is essential for a long-lasting and stable patio.
Your contractor should begin by excavating the area to a sufficient depth, typically 4-6 inches, and removing any grass, roots, or debris.
Next, they will grade the soil to ensure proper drainage away from your home and any adjacent structures.
| Foundation Preparation Step | Purpose | Importance |
|---|---|---|
| Excavation | Remove topsoil and create a level base | Prevents settling and shifting |
| Grading | Establish proper slope for drainage | Avoids water pooling and damage |
| Compaction | Stabilize the subgrade | Provides a solid foundation |
A well-prepared foundation is crucial for preventing cracks, settling, and other issues down the line.
Addressing Drainage and Slope Issues for a Functional Concrete Patio
Proper drainage is key to maintaining the integrity of your concrete patio and preventing water damage to your home.
Your contractor should incorporate a slight slope, typically 1/4 inch per foot, to direct water away from the house.
They may also install a drainage system, such as a French drain or catch basin, to manage runoff during heavy rains.
| Drainage Solution | Function | Benefits |
|---|---|---|
| Proper Slope | Directs water away from the house | Prevents pooling and foundation damage |
| French Drain | Collects and redirects subsurface water | Keeps soil dry and stable |
| Catch Basin | Captures surface runoff | Prevents erosion and flooding |
By addressing drainage issues from the start, you can avoid costly repairs and ensure the longevity of your patio.
Exploring the Best Concrete Finish Options for Your Patio in Salt Lake City
One of the great things about concrete patios is the variety of finishes available to customize the look and feel of your outdoor space.
Some popular options include:
- Broom finish – a textured, slip-resistant surface created by dragging a broom across the wet concrete
- Exposed aggregate – a decorative finish that reveals the natural stone or gravel within the concrete mix
- Stamped concrete – a technique that imprints patterns or textures to mimic the look of brick, stone, or tile
Your contractor can help you choose a finish that complements your home’s architecture and suits your personal style.
| Finish | Appearance | Maintenance |
|---|---|---|
| Broom | Textured, slip-resistant | Low, easy to clean |
| Exposed Aggregate | Decorative, natural stone look | Moderate, may require resealing |
| Stamped | Mimics brick, stone, or tile | Higher, needs regular sealing |
Consider both the aesthetic appeal and the maintenance requirements when selecting a finish for your patio.
